The migrant people hunger for amusement. In the camps along the road, they gather around storytellers, who weave heartfelt tales. If migrants have the money, they go to movies. Afterward, they talk to other migrants about the amazing stories they saw on-screen. Migrants sometimes get drunk and daydream about old times.

WebSummary and Analysis Chapter 23. The migrant people search for pleasures as they search for food and work, a necessity for survival during the hard times. They tell stories to one another, some made-up, some from the movie pictures. Those with a little money get drunk to deaden the pain of their situation. Others play music: Harmonica, guitar ...
